-What are the healthy characteristics of a healthy mature inner adult?  

Many have never learn what is normal for a healthy adult self, especially growing up in a dysfunctional home.    

KEY POINT: "Resists the forces to fit in with the group ethos when it contradicts their values"  Number 6 of the 7 part series  Our aim is to resist group think, group feel, the family superself, the workplace superself, and following the herd.  Stating I-positions without reactivity, with calmness, and focusing on Self when dealing with others and the group ethos (values, morals, opinions).  Staying in contact means we do not retreat nor do we attack or become reactive in relationships in which we disagree with others.     Jerry Wise is presenting a seven part series of videos on the 7 Characteristics of a Healthy Inner Adult listed in the book by Jenny Brown, "Growing Yourself Up".  He explains each one.  Jerry Wise, MA, MS, CLC has been a family therapist and life and life and relationship coach.  He and his team work with individuals, couples, and families and businesses to become strong self-differentiating people and leaders.
